UIActionInterpreter Sınıf
Bir kullanıcı arabirimi (UI) test test eylemi yürütür, sonuçları yorumlama ve bir günlük dosyasına yazar.
Devralma Hiyerarşisi
System.Object
Microsoft.VisualStudio.TestTools.UITest.Common.UITestActionInvoker
Microsoft.VisualStudio.TestTools.UITest.CodeGeneration.UIActionInterpreter
Ad alanı: Microsoft.VisualStudio.TestTools.UITest.CodeGeneration
Derleme: Microsoft.VisualStudio.TestTools.UITest.CodeGeneration (Microsoft.VisualStudio.TestTools.UITest.CodeGeneration.dll içinde)
Sözdizimi
'Bildirim
Public NotInheritable Class UIActionInterpreter _
Inherits UITestActionInvoker
public sealed class UIActionInterpreter : UITestActionInvoker
public ref class UIActionInterpreter sealed : public UITestActionInvoker
[<Sealed>]
type UIActionInterpreter =
class
inherit UITestActionInvoker
end
public final class UIActionInterpreter extends UITestActionInvoker
UIActionInterpreter türü aşağıdaki üyeleri ortaya koyar.
Oluşturucular
Ad | Açıklama | |
---|---|---|
![]() |
UIActionInterpreter | Yeni bir örneğini başlatır UIActionInterpreter sınıfı kullanarak belirli bir yorumlayıcı. |
Üst
Özellikler
Ad | Açıklama | |
---|---|---|
![]() |
CurrentBrowser | Alır veya ayarlar geçerli tarayıcı sürümü ve adını içeren bir dize. |
![]() |
DelayBetweenActions | Alır veya her eylemi çalıştırmadan önce gecikme süresini ayarlar. |
![]() |
InRetryMode | Alır veya yorumlayıcı yeniden deneme modunda olup olmadığını gösteren bir değeri ayarlar. (UITestActionInvoker.InRetryMode geçersiz kılınır.) |
![]() |
SearchTimeout | Alır veya bir arama işlemi süresi dolmadan önce saniye sayısını ayarlar. |
![]() |
ThinkTimeMultiplier | Alır veya ayarlar çarpan düşünme süresi değerleri için kullanın. |
![]() |
TopLevelWindowSinglePassSearch | Alır veya üst düzey pencere için kullanılacak tek geçiş arama olup olmadığını gösteren bir değeri ayarlar. |
Üst
Yöntemler
Ad | Açıklama | |
---|---|---|
![]() |
Cancel | Ne zaman denilen Kayıttan yürütme iptal düğmesi, kullanıcı tarafından tıklatıldığında. (UITestActionInvoker.Cancel() geçersiz kılınır.) |
![]() |
Dispose | Kaynakları serbest bırakır. (UITestActionInvoker.Dispose() geçersiz kılınır.) |
![]() |
Equals | Belirler olup belirtilen Object eşittir geçerli Object. (Object kaynağından devralındı.) |
![]() |
Finalize | Kaynakları boşaltın ve atık toplama işlemi tarafından iadesi önce diğer temizleme işlemleri gerçekleştirmek nesne izin verir. (Object kaynağından devralındı.) |
![]() |
GetHashCode | Belirli bir tip için sağlama işlevini yerine getirir. (Object kaynağından devralındı.) |
![]() |
GetType | Alır Type geçerli bir örneği. (Object kaynağından devralındı.) |
![]() |
Invoke(AssertA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(AssertA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(BrowserA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(BrowserA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(DelayA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(DelayA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(DragA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(DragA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(DragDropA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(DragDropA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(ErrorA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(ErrorA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(KeyboardA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(KeyboardA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(LaunchApplicationA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(LaunchApplicationA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(MarkerA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(MarkerA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(MouseA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(MouseA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(NavigateToUrlA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(NavigateToUrlA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(NoOperationA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(NoOperationA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(SendKeysA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(SendKeysA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(SetStateA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(SetStateA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(SetValueA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(SetValueA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(SharedStepsReferenceA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(SharedStepsReferenceA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(StringAssertA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(StringAssertA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(TestStepMarkerA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(TestStepMarkerA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(VerifyConfigurationA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(VerifyConfigurationA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(WarningA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(WarningAction, UIMap) geçersiz kılınır.) |
![]() |
Invoke(WebDialogAction, UIMap) |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u günlüğe kaydeder. (UITestActionInvoker.Invoke(WebDialogAction, UIMap) geçersiz kılınır.) |
![]() |
MemberwiseClone | Geçerli yüzeysel bir kopyasını oluşturur Object. (Object kaynağından devralındı.) |
![]() |
SearchAndInvoke | Verilen haritayı kullanarak sağlanan eylemi yürütür ve sonucu özel Invoker şeklinizle kullanarak kaydeder. (UITestActionInvoker.SearchAndInvoke(UITestAction, UIMap, CustomInvoker) geçersiz kılınır.) |
![]() |
ToString | Geçerli nesneyi temsil eden bir dize döndürür. (Object kaynağından devralındı.) |
![]() |
WaitForThinkTime | Sağlanan eylem çağrılmadan önce düşünme süresi uygun büyüklükte bekler. (UITestActionInvoker.WaitForThinkTime(UITestAction) geçersiz kılınır.) |
Üst
İş Parçacığı Güvenliği
Bu türün tüm genel statik (Visual Basic'te Shared) üyeleri iş parçacığı açısından güvenlidir. Hiçbir örnek üyesinin iş parçacığı açısından güvenliği garanti edilemez.
Ayrıca bkz.
Başvuru
Microsoft.VisualStudio.TestTools.UITest.CodeGeneration Ad Alanı